No $500 paint job, is a paint job you want...

I wouldn't paint my jeep with a perfectly fine paint job (maybe someday 20 years from now when its absolutely beat), but if I did I would get somethign that costs more than $500 b/c I would be afraid to see what a $500 paint job looks like - I'm thinking Maaco?!

I've had one of my previous cars custom painted before and there is a lot that goes into a good paint job (removing all windows, lights, painting jambs, inside hood, trunk, etc.) and it *has* to cost more than $500 if done right. That paint job cost me over $2500 and it was a compact car; I've heard of places charging even more than that...
